To make the humus
In a blender, put in the chickpeas. Discard the liquid. Go in with the garlic clove, olive oil, vinegar and salt to taste.
Give it a blend and then add in the tahini and ice cubes. Blend until smooth then pour over a plate.
Garnish with olive oil and serve with some carrot strips or sticks. Enjoy!
